The aircraft maintenance engineering (ame) course in Kerala generally has a duration of three years, divided into six semesters. During this period, students undergo comprehensive theoretical and practical training in various aspects of aircraft maintenance, repair, and inspection. The curriculum covers subjects such as aircraft systems, propulsion systems, avionics, maintenance practices, and regulatory requirements. In addition to classroom lectures, students also participate in hands-on training sessions, laboratory experiments, and workshops to develop their practical skills. The course is designed to equip students with the knowledge, skills, and competencies required to obtain an aircraft maintenance engineer's license and pursue a career in the aviation industry.
